Output e61e8fc2cb2948b0df676e3cb9a63b028b2fde2a530cdda763447cb4d8d98bd2:1

value
5064293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b906a56a625bf31fb0f8e6f45e29840c5a8c29 OP_EQUAL
address
3FhpxitQQe7ZAaBSrqF9zaXha8mQfY3peV
transaction
e61e8fc2cb2948b0df676e3cb9a63b028b2fde2a530cdda763447cb4d8d98bd2
confirmations
312629
spent
true